CYTJ45/2 Twin-Boom Mining Drilling Jumbo

The CRCHI CYTJ45/2 is a medium-to-large twin-boom mining hydraulic drilling jumbo for blast-hole and rock-bolt-hole drilling in underground drifts and tunnels. Two parallel-holding hydraulic booms cover a 9 m by 6.8 m maximum working face down to a 4 m by 4 m minimum section, drilling 45 to 89 mm holes to 4 m on a single rod at up to 3 m/min, with a quoted parallel hole-group positioning accuracy of ±0.5° and approximately 10% reduction in positioning time per cycle. The platform runs an articulated four-wheel-drive rubber-tyred chassis with hydrodynamic transmission, wet axle, parking brake and service brake, FOPS/ROPS certified canopy as standard (FOPS/ROPS enclosed cab optional), and a Yuchai 81 kW Tier 4-equivalent diesel as standard with Yuchai 81 kW Tier 3-equivalent, Yuchai 90 kW Euro V and a high-altitude module as options. The CYTJ45/2(Z) variant overlays a fully computerised control system: blast-hole plans built in CRCHI mine design software import directly into the jumbo, an on-board scanner captures the working-face point cloud, drilling executes automatically along pre-defined paths with adaptive anti-jamming and anti-idle-strike, MWD and electronic operation logs are generated per round, and an optional remote-control module supports beyond-line-of-sight operation; the FOPS/ROPS enclosed cab is standard. Overview

Applications

A medium-to-large twin-boom drilling jumbo for blast-hole and rock-bolt drilling in underground drifts and tunnels, working face widths from 4 m × 4 m up to 9 m × 6.8 m at 45 to 89 mm hole diameters and 4 m hole depth. Suited to mining adits and development drives, water-conservancy and hydropower headrace and access tunnels, national defence works and other underground rock-drilling applications where two booms drilling in parallel cut round time over single-boom platforms. The hydraulic CYTJ45/2 baseline suits operators specifying conventional manual face mark-out and operator-driven drilling. The intelligent CYTJ45/2(Z) suits operators specifying digital tunnelling design import, scanner-driven face capture, automatic drill-pattern execution and electronic operation logs, with optional remote-control beyond-line-of-sight operation. Benefits

Two booms drilling in parallel from one chassis cut drill-cycle time per round at the same face section without doubling tramming, water, air or operator overhead. Full-range parallel holding and ±0.5° hole-group accuracy on the hydraulic variant tighten pattern conformance and reduce overbreak risk; the intelligent variant takes marking-out and per-hole trajectory planning out of operator hands by executing imported blast-hole plans automatically with high-precision boom control and motion-trajectory planning. Anti-idle-strike, anti-jamming and automatic retraction extend rock-drill life. Centralised lubrication, automatic shank lubrication, a pneumatic grease pump and high component commonality across the CRCHI mining drilling-jumbo line shorten daily maintenance and shop time.
